| func checkKernel() error { |
| // Check for unsupported kernel versions |
| // FIXME: it would be cleaner to not test for specific versions, but rather |
| // test for specific functionalities. |
| // Unfortunately we can't test for the feature "does not cause a kernel panic" |
| // without actually causing a kernel panic, so we need this workaround until |
| // the circumstances of pre-3.10 crashes are clearer. |
| // For details see https://github.com/docker/docker/issues/407 |
| if !checkKernelVersion(3, 10, 0) { |
| v, _ := kernel.GetKernelVersion() |
| if os.Getenv("DOCKER_NOWARN_KERNEL_VERSION") == "" { |
| logrus.Warnf("Your Linux kernel version %s can be unstable running docker. Please upgrade your kernel to 3.10.0.", v.String()) |
| } |
| } |
| return nil |
| } |

| // adaptContainerSettings is called during container creation to modify any |
| // settings necessary in the HostConfig structure. |
| func (daemon *Daemon) adaptContainerSettings(hostConfig *runconfig.HostConfig, adjustCPUShares bool) { |
| if hostConfig == nil { |
| return |
| } |
| |
| if adjustCPUShares && hostConfig.CPUShares > 0 { |
| // Handle unsupported CPUShares |
| if hostConfig.CPUShares < linuxMinCPUShares { |
| logrus.Warnf("Changing requested CPUShares of %d to minimum allowed of %d", hostConfig.CPUShares, linuxMinCPUShares) |
| hostConfig.CPUShares = linuxMinCPUShares |
| } else if hostConfig.CPUShares > linuxMaxCPUShares { |
| logrus.Warnf("Changing requested CPUShares of %d to maximum allowed of %d", hostConfig.CPUShares, linuxMaxCPUShares) |
| hostConfig.CPUShares = linuxMaxCPUShares |
| } |
| } |
| if hostConfig.Memory > 0 && hostConfig.MemorySwap == 0 { |
| // By default, MemorySwap is set to twice the size of Memory. |
| hostConfig.MemorySwap = hostConfig.Memory * 2 |
| } |
| if hostConfig.MemoryReservation == 0 && hostConfig.Memory > 0 { |
| hostConfig.MemoryReservation = hostConfig.Memory |
| } |
| } |

| // setupInitLayer populates a directory with mountpoints suitable |
| // for bind-mounting dockerinit into the container. The mountpoint is simply an |
| // empty file at /.dockerinit |
| // |
| // This extra layer is used by all containers as the top-most ro layer. It protects |
| // the container from unwanted side-effects on the rw layer. |
| func setupInitLayer(initLayer string, rootUID, rootGID int) error { |
| for pth, typ := range map[string]string{ |
| "/dev/pts": "dir", |
| "/dev/shm": "dir", |
| "/proc": "dir", |
| "/sys": "dir", |
| "/.dockerinit": "file", |
| "/.dockerenv": "file", |
| "/etc/resolv.conf": "file", |
| "/etc/hosts": "file", |
| "/etc/hostname": "file", |
| "/dev/console": "file", |
| "/etc/mtab": "/proc/mounts", |
| } { |
| parts := strings.Split(pth, "/") |
| prev := "/" |
| for _, p := range parts[1:] { |
| prev = filepath.Join(prev, p) |
| syscall.Unlink(filepath.Join(initLayer, prev)) |
| } |
| |
| if _, err := os.Stat(filepath.Join(initLayer, pth)); err != nil { |
| if os.IsNotExist(err) { |
| if err := idtools.MkdirAllAs(filepath.Join(initLayer, filepath.Dir(pth)), 0755, rootUID, rootGID); err != nil { |
| return err |
| } |
| switch typ { |
| case "dir": |
| if err := idtools.MkdirAllAs(filepath.Join(initLayer, pth), 0755, rootUID, rootGID); err != nil { |
| return err |
| } |
| case "file": |
| f, err := os.OpenFile(filepath.Join(initLayer, pth), os.O_CREATE, 0755) |
| if err != nil { |
| return err |
| } |
| f.Close() |
| f.Chown(rootUID, rootGID) |
| default: |
| if err := os.Symlink(typ, filepath.Join(initLayer, pth)); err != nil { |
| return err |
| } |
| } |
| } else { |
| return err |
| } |
| } |
| } |
| |
| // Layer is ready to use, if it wasn't before. |
| return nil |
| } |
